Career Path

Loading...
In the UK food writing industry, several roles have gained significant traction, with the following distribution: * **Food Blogger (40%)**: With the rise of digital media, food blogging has become an essential platform for sharing culinary experiences, recipes, and restaurant reviews. * **Recipe Developer (30%)**: Professionals in this role create innovative and delicious recipes for various platforms, including digital media, cookbooks, and food magazines. * **Food Journalist (15%)**: Food journalists report on culinary trends, restaurant openings, and other food-related news, often contributing to newspapers, magazines, and online publications. * **Restaurant Critic (10%)**: Restaurant critics provide detailed reviews of dining establishments, helping readers make informed decisions about where to dine. * **Food Content Curator (5%)**: Food content curators collect, organize, and present relevant food content for websites, social media, and other digital platforms. By understanding the role distribution and industry relevance of each position, aspiring food writers can make informed decisions about their career paths.
